Description
WHAT DO YOU LOVE TO DO? Award Winning Children's Book, Bilingual - Japanese & English Help your child discover their hidden talents! All children are born with something they are good at. It is important for adults to discover them, but it is also important for children to discover for themselves what they are good at. When children are able to discover for themselves what they are good at, it is a powerful force that will have a great impact on their future. This picture book gives children the chance to discover their hidden talents. This picture book gives children such a chance. Winner of the 2021 Book Contest [Excellent Effort Award] sponsored by Story Monsters, Inc. of the United States. About the Author Maki*Nicio*Phipps Writer*illustrator*painter*translator. Born in Fukuoka, raised in Tokyo. Has lived in the U.S. for over 40 years. After graduating from Aoyama Gakuin Women's Junior College with a degree in English Literature, she moved to the United States in 1976. Studied graphic design at Eastern Michigan University. She illustrated the book "Happy English" (published by Shueisha) by singer Agnes Chan. He also worked as an illustrator for Morinaga Seika Co. Since 1986, he has also worked as a translator for the Japanese and U.S. automotive manufacturing industries. In 2020, he began selling his paintings in the gift store of the Biltmore, a tourist attraction in the United States. Currently working mainly on picture book production. |
